|
| 2 timeout på en gang ? Fra : BGitte |
Dato : 22-10-04 12:01 |
|
Kan man have 2 timeout kørende på en gang,
og hvordan gør man det ?
| |
*XxX* (22-10-2004)
| Kommentar Fra : *XxX* |
Dato : 22-10-04 13:49 |
|
"BGitte" <bgit@nrdaspam@nspamsu.org> wrote in message
news:c2qhn0t0p4364likaoch8seil23nnaihdh@4ax.com...
>
> Kan man have 2 timeout kørende på en gang,
> og hvordan gør man det ?
>
ID1 = setTimeout('alert(\'hej\')', 500);
ID2 = setTimeout('alert(\'hej 2\')', 1000);
clearTimeout(ID1);
| |
BGitte (22-10-2004)
| Kommentar Fra : BGitte |
Dato : 22-10-04 14:03 |
|
On Fri, 22 Oct 2004 14:48:55 +0200, "*XxX*" <fatman00hot@hotmail.com>
wrote:
> ID1 = setTimeout('alert(\'hej\')', 500);
> ID2 = setTimeout('alert(\'hej 2\')', 1000);
> clearTimeout(ID1);
Hmmm, den ene kører den anden gør ikke,
men det ser ud til at den starter.
| |
*XxX* (22-10-2004)
| Kommentar Fra : *XxX* |
Dato : 22-10-04 14:18 |
|
"BGitte" <bgitnrdaspam@nspamsu.org> wrote in message
news:r61in0hl48on7ejsc0u9b1fnnmqosb92jp@4ax.com...
> On Fri, 22 Oct 2004 14:48:55 +0200, "*XxX*" <fatman00hot@hotmail.com>
> wrote:
>
> > ID1 = setTimeout('alert(\'hej\')', 500);
> > ID2 = setTimeout('alert(\'hej 2\')', 1000);
> > clearTimeout(ID1);
>
> Hmmm, den ene kører den anden gør ikke,
> men det ser ud til at den starter.
Ja det er jo også det der er meningen.
ID1 = setTimeout('alert(\'hej\')', 500); (Den første timeout bliver startet)
ID2 = setTimeout('alert(\'hej 2\')', 1000); (Den anden timeout bliver
startet)
clearTimeout(ID1); (Den første timeout bliver slettet)
| |
BGitte (22-10-2004)
| Kommentar Fra : BGitte |
Dato : 22-10-04 15:50 |
|
On Fri, 22 Oct 2004 15:17:46 +0200, "*XxX*" <fatman00hot@hotmail.com>
wrote:
> Ja det er jo også det der er meningen.
Nej :)
1 starter og kører, stopper ikke.
2 starter og kører 5000, action.
| |
BGitte (22-10-2004)
| Kommentar Fra : BGitte |
Dato : 22-10-04 16:09 |
|
Igen: Meningen er at:
1 starter og kører, stopper ikke.
2 starter og kører 5000, action.
| |
*XxX* (22-10-2004)
| Kommentar Fra : *XxX* |
Dato : 22-10-04 22:56 |
|
"BGitte" <bgitnrdaspam@nspamsu.org> wrote in message
news:qi8in0d9j27luenonn1js1i8l380ccjhuh@4ax.com...
>
> Igen: Meningen er at:
> 1 starter og kører, stopper ikke.
> 2 starter og kører 5000, action.
>
Det var også bare for at vise hvordan man kunne stoppe en timeout og
meningen med det jeg skev var at man kunne se at ID1 stoppede.
Så du glemmer bare alt om clearTimeout og så har du jo det andet med 2
forskellige start tidspunkter
ID1=setTimeout('funktion1()', 1000000)
ID2=setTimeout('funktion2()', 5000)
| |
|
|